Transaction d28a09823afeeeee59827ae89efe41097c10a5cad62d72744a80e9eb76946220
1 Input
1 Output
-
d28a09823afeeeee59827ae89efe41097c10a5cad62d72744a80e9eb76946220:0
- value
- 399998460
- script pubkey
- OP_0 OP_PUSHBYTES_20 c104edf643da4aef2cc600bd7c003d970976b54d
- address
- bc1qcyzwmajrmf9w7txxqz7hcqpajuyhdd2dzyetvx